The struggle started when the endangered kind of bear, who is now 25 years old, was a kid.

Cholita was taken from her mother and eventually ended up at a carnival in Peru.

Since then, she has been forced to live in tiny cages, with the only time she is permitted to leave being when she performs for paying customers.

Even worse, she endured unspeakable torture throughout her time there. She still bears the scars of her difficult upbringing generations later.

The removal of all the animals occurred even before authorities realised that the circus was operating legally, giving the depressed bear some hope.

Since Cholita was moved from the circus to a park, she was unable to enjoy freedom, and it now appears that the mistreated animal has no chance of recovery.

But ten years later, everything changed when Jan Creamer, the head of Animal Defenders Worldwide (ADI), accidentally learned of Cholita’s story.

Creamer was driven to place her in a better setting and only gave up when the bears were set free.

Cholita was moved at an ADI rescue centre at first, and then she was taken to her final destination.

She might call the Taricaya Environmental Conservancy home because the area is well-known for being a natural habitat for spectacled animals.
